Upscale Resale for Bump to Baby and Beyond

The Sharing Squirrel offers a perfectly curated selection of new and used products, but perhaps is most well know for it’s incredible selection of previously-loved clothing and baby gear for expecting mamas, babies and toddlers. The friendly and knowledgeable staff carefully select and purchase these items from families who have outgrown them. All resale items are chosen based on condition, need, and style in order to offer customers the highest quality at prices growing families can afford.

Within the store is The Sharing Squirrel’s newest project, The Nesting Squirrel. This area of the shop caters to expecting mamas with a wide selection of fashionable, upscale resale maternity clothing for every occasion. And the best part?! You can actually try on the clothing!!

More than Clothing

Not only does this shop offer a variety of clothing for young families, but it is full of baby gear such as strollers and baby carriers, as well as, accessories, toys, books and more! Beyond resale items is an array of stylish, sustainable baby and toddler products, many of which are Canadian- and local artisan-made.

The store itself is full of great finds and the calm and clean atmosphere of the store is worth the drive, but for those who need or prefer online shopping, the Squirrel’s website is full of new and used items waiting for you to discover. The team works hard to upload clothing items frequently, and pack up and send off purchased items as quick as possible.

Small Business, Big Heart

As mentioned, Laura has a big heart; she is always thinking of what she can do to help beyond the offerings of the store itself. Prior to the pandemic, The Squirrel hosted events right in the store, all catering to mamas. Info nights, DIY events, and mini classes, if Laura saw a need or an opportunity to support another local entrepreneur, she fulfilled it. The store also often hosts affordable Photography Mini Sessions for holidays such as Valentine’s Day, Easter and Christmas.

Laura is also very passionate about charity work. The Squirrel works as a Charity Partner with Mamas for Mamas, a specialized poverty relief agency and an all inclusive community for mothers and caregivers. When you sell your used items to the Squirrel, any unpurchased items can be left behind and donated to this organization.

The shop has also hosted Diaper Drives and fundraisers, including the Silent Heroes auction which included donations from over 80 local businesses and raised $8, 206 for Grand River Hospital’s Covid-19 Support and Readiness Fund.

The Sharing Squirrel also supports many other small businesses, and carries items in store and online made by over 20 different local vendors, all very talented in their crafts. Everything from handmade children’s clothing to wooden toys, natural baby teethers, knit booties and teddies, stylish hair accessories, and so much more.
